Chestnut Purée

Chestnut purée from Erken's Stor kokebok: chestnuts are blanched and peeled, cooked tender in bouillon with a celery stalk, pressed through a sieve, stirred with butter and cream, seasoned and served in small croustades with goose, duck or pork loin.

Source: Henriette Schønberg Erken, Stor kokebok, 1914-utg. s. 386 (falt i det fri)

About the dish

Chestnut purée was a fine accompaniment to fatty roasts such as goose, duck and pork loin. Erken recommends serving the purée in small croustades, a typical presentation at the festive bourgeois meals of the time.

How to make it

  1. 1

    Peel the chestnuts

    Cut a cross in the chestnuts, give them a quick boil in boiling water and remove the shell and inner skin at once while they are hot.

  2. 2

    Cook tender

    Put the chestnuts in a pot with the bouillon and the celery stalk and cook until completely tender.

  3. 3

    Pass through a sieve

    Press the chestnuts through a fine-mesh sieve or potato ricer into a purée.

  4. 4

    Season

    Stir in the butter, season with salt and pepper, add the cream and give the purée another quick boil.

  5. 5

    Serve

    Serve preferably in small croustades with goose, duck and pork loin.

Changes from the original

Measures are converted to modern units (del. → dl, gr. → g, spoonfuls → tablespoons). The hair sieve is replaced with a fine-mesh sieve or potato ricer. The OCR error "4 kg. chestnuts" is interpreted as ½ kg.

Frequently asked questions

What is the easiest way to peel the chestnuts?
Cut a cross in the shell, give them a quick boil in boiling water and remove the shell and inner skin at once – while they are hot. The skin then loosens much more easily.
What is the chestnut purée served with?
According to the recipe, preferably in small croustades as an accompaniment to goose, duck and pork loin.
What is the purée made of, and how long does it cook?
½ kg chestnuts, 4–5 dl bouillon, 30 g butter, a celery stalk, 2–3 spoonfuls of cream plus salt and pepper. The chestnuts are cooked in the stock with the celery stalk until completely tender, pressed through a fine sieve, blended with butter and cream and given another quick boil. Figure on about an hour in total.
